That appears to be a USB-only Printer.


In that case, some device has to hold it, and to talk to the Printer, you need to Address your print request to the device it is attached to. For Windows, you may need Bonjour for Windows (a free download) to help discover the Printer attached to a Mac device or AirPort Base Station.


What wireless protocol is used to access the device holding the printer is of no importance whatsoever.


By the time these printers get delivered at Retail, the drivers are already obsolete. You will need to download new ones if Software Update has not already provided them.
